Mexico has set up thorough labeling laws to make certain transparency, shield public wellness, and aid people make knowledgeable choices. The Mexico labeling necessities are significantly arduous for food items and beverage merchandise. Food items LABELING IN MEXICO have to adhere to certain rules and rules, largely governed because of the Official Mexican Typical N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010. This normal outlines the required labeling data for all pre-packaged food and non-alcoholic beverages marketed in the place. It relates to equally domestic and imported products, which makes it important for companies to comply with these labeling benchmarks in Mexico in order to avoid penalties and sector rejection.

One of several central features in the Mexican labeling procedure will be the implementation of Foodstuff WARNING LABELS IN MEXICO. These labels are part of a broader public wellness initiative to handle growing weight problems and diabetic issues fees within the population. The front-of-package deal labeling in Mexico (also called Entrance of Pack Labeling Mexico or Front-of-pack Diet Warning Labels in Mexico) mandates the inclusion of black octagonal warning indications to the entrance of food items packaging. These warnings warn individuals if an item is superior in energy, sugar, sodium, saturated Fats, or incorporates caffeine or sweeteners that ought to be prevented by young children. This Mexican front-of-pack labeling reform was officially rolled out in phases, commencing in Oct 2020, and signifies a major shift in the way in which nutritional info is presented.

Mexican labeling standards also call for comprehensive knowledge on the packaging. The overall labeling of products and solutions in Mexico need to involve the item title, component record, net written content, producer information, place of origin, expiration day, and storage instructions. All this must be presented in Spanish, and any misleading claims are strictly prohibited. Additionally, the Mexico labeling/marking prerequisites make sure that labels are legible, indelible, and placed the place These are simply seen to The patron. These procedures variety part of the mandatory requirements of labeling needs in Mexico and therefore are enforced by authorities including PROFECO and COFEPRIS.

Mexico's authorities demands for labeling are notably rigid In relation to imported products. Imported food and beverage solutions have to comply with Mexican NOM labeling for meals, including adapting the packaging to incorporate the right warnings, nutritional panels, and also other pertinent details according to the Mexican Formal Standard N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010. This normally consists of relabeling merchandise or applying stickers for NOM-051 compliance right before They can be allowed available. This sort of labels must not obscure the initial item labeling and ought to supply all required information in Spanish. As such, firms exporting to Mexico must be properly-versed in the Mexico labeling regulation to guarantee label compliance (NOM Mexico).

The Mexican Formal conventional N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010 mandates distinct, legible, and truthful details. Solutions will have to not use conditions like “purely natural” or “healthy” unless they meet strict criteria. The Mexico meals law also restricts marketing features on packaging that comprise a number of warning labels. These actions discourage misleading claims and encourage food stuff providers to reformulate their products and solutions to stay away from labeling penalties. Subsequently, some corporations have minimized sugar, salt, and Unwanted fat within their recipes to tumble underneath the thresholds that bring about front-of-offer warnings.
